[0034] Such as figure 1 As shown, the fusion method of 2D photoelectric video and 3D scene in the present invention is divided into four modules, including geolocation, distortion correction, image registration and dynamic texture mapping. Combining the aircraft attitude angle, aircraft position and line of sight information provided by the inertial navigation, as well as the visualized three-dimensional scene, the geographic positioning is realized. The distortion parameters determined by the sensor image combined with the calibration process are corrected. According to the results of geolocation, the image of the location area is image-registered with the real-time photodetection video frame. Finally, according to the offset-compensated area, the corrected image is used as the texture for mapping. The specific calculation process is described in detail below:
